Make a Schedule and Stick to It

When it comes to office relocation, your schedule is top priority. Pay careful consideration to the needs of your business, your office, your employees, and your customers or clients. Choose viable installation days and schedule accordingly. From this starting point, schedule blocks of time for your employees to clear their spaces and prepare for the move – along with any other activities that need to be arranged.

Incorporate Employee Productivity

An office relocation can leave your employees in a kind of productivity limbo. As your move progresses, your employees may not understand their interim roles. Consider employee productivity and get creative in the process of planning your transition. Working remotely, furthering training, or visiting clients onsite are all great employee options. Think about what makes sense for your business.
